MAIN REQUIREMENTS 
Brakes must be strong enough to stop the vehicle 
within the possible distance in an emergency. (safety) 
Brakes should have good anti-fade characteristics also 
on constant prolonged application its effectiveness 
should not decrease.
STOPPING DISTANCE OF A VEHICAL DEPENDS 
Vehicle speed 
Condition of road surface. 
Condition of tyre thread. 
Coefficient of friction b/w tyre thread & road surface. 
Coefficient of friction b/w brake disc/drum & brake 
pad. 
Braking force applied by the driver.

TYPES OF BRAKE MATERIALS 
Grey cast iron disc 
 Heavy 
 Rust formation 
Aluminium disc 
 Light 
 Less resistant to heat and fade 
Carbon-fiber disc 
 Heat resistant 
 Needs high working temperature 
Ceramic disc 
 Inorganic and non-metallic 
 Hard and brittle material 
 High heat and abrasive resistance 
 Can sustain large compressive load
CERAMIC DISC BRAKES AND CONVENTIONAL 
DISC BRAKES 
Grey cast iron disc is heavy which reduces acceleration, 
uses more fuel. 
Ceramic disc brake weighs less than conventional disc 
brakes but have same frictional values, used in F-1 racing 
cars etc. 
CDB good at wet conditions but conventional disc fails in 
wet conditions. 
CDBs are 61% lighter, reduces 20kg of car, apart we can 
save the fuel, resulting in better mileage. Improve the 
shock absorber. We can add more safety features instead 
of the current weight.
MANUFACTURE OF CERAMIC DISC BRAKE 
In earlier days disc brakes were made from 
conventional brittle ceramic material. 
DIAMLER CHRYSLER made carbon fibre 
reinforce brake disc to avoid the brittle property. 
Short carbon fibres + carbon powder + resin 
mix(at 1000 c sintering) = stable carbon frame 
work. 
After cooling ground like wood brake disc obtains 
its shape. 
Add silicon to the required shape and insert in the 
furnace for the second time. 
Resins : thermo plastics resins and thermo setting 
resins .
COATING OF CERAMIC ON CONVENTIONAL 
BRAKE DISCS 
FRENO Ltd. used metal matrix composite for disc, an 
alloy of aluminum for lightness and silicon carbides 
for strength. The ceramic additive made the disc 
highly abrasive and gave a low unstable coefficient of 
friction. 
SULZER METCO Ltd. special ceramic coating, 
developed thermal spray technology as well as 
manufacturing plasma surface.

ADVANTAGES 
50% lighter than metal disc brakes, reduces 20kg of car. 
Apart from saving fuel also reduce unsprung masses with a 
further improvement of shock absorber response & 
behavior. 
High frictional values in deceleration process Porsche- 100 
to 0 km in 3 sec. 
Brake temperature. 
Resistance up to 2000 c . 
Still runs after 300000 km need not change CDB. 
No wear, maintenance free and heat and rust resistant even 
under high oxygen concentration. 
Heavy commercial can be braked safely over long distance 
without maintenance.
DISADVANTAGE 
High initial cost and high cost of production.
